Output 34c91886c369661eddca45f39c18a037b15b40447282d18ffbd6b44dce75da41:10

value
1053026
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c5245848b852a059fdb61247fc63ca82ce9782d OP_EQUALVERIFY OP_CHECKSIG
address
17xYuubjvi8AyFeEPt8yw7gbogE68s8cfG
transaction
34c91886c369661eddca45f39c18a037b15b40447282d18ffbd6b44dce75da41
spent
true